So, you have decided you want to work with Steiner at sea on a luxury cruise ship. The question is now, do you have what it takes? Steiner only hires fully-qualified staff. Click on your region below to find out what diplomas we accept for each profession.
Massage Therapists (Click for more info)
- Must be qualified in Swedish/Sports massage with NVQ, ITEC, VTCT, (minimum 150 hours)
- Any additional courses, e.g. aromatherapy, reflexology, Indian head massage, Reiki, remedial massage is beneficial
- Massage with Facial Electrics
- Level 2 NVQ and Level 3 NVQ (Massage)
Beauty therapists (Click for more info)
- Cidesco, Itec, Inter clinitique, ROC,
or IA College
- We also accept National diplomas, with a minimum of 2 years and include the following subjects: Face cleansing therapy, face electrical treatments, electrical body treatments, manicure, pedicure and full body massage
Personal Trainer (Click for more info)
- Need to have two certificates;
—1/ PT training certificate or Sport academy diploma
- Any other courses such as Tai Bo, yoga, pilates, circuit training, body balancing, spinning, Les Mills certificates are only a bonus, but not essential
Nail technicians (Click for more info)
- Need to have a certificate for the system acrylic nails as a basic. This can be the creative system, easy flow system, OPI system
- Nail technicians need to have 1-year experience and be able to do a new full set of acrylic nails in 1 hour 10 minutes
- You will also be asked to demonstrate a polish
Receptionist (Click for more info)
- Your English needs to be of a very high level and you need to speak at least one of the following languages; Italian, Spanish, French, Portuguese
- You are the face of the spa, therefore you will need to have an exceptional professional appearance and excellent communication skills
- Work experience as receptionist in a Fitness centre, Beauty centre, or Hairdressing salon would be a bonus
Hairdressers (Click for more info)
- Diplomas from a National college are accepted
- The education will need to be a minimum of 2 years and hairdressers will need to have an additional 1-year full time work experience as a hairdresser
